Fly ash (FA) and vinasse (VN), two industrial wastes, are generated in huge amounts and cause serious hazards to the environment. In this experiment, different proportions of these two wastes were used as food for two epigeic earthworms (Eisenia fetida and Eudrilus eugeniae) to standardize the recycling technique of these two wastes and to study their effect on fungal especially cellulolytic fungal population, cellulase activity and their isozyme pattern, chitin content and microbial biomass of waste mixture during vermicomposting. Increasing VN proportion from 25% to 50% or even higher, counts of both fungi and cellulolytic fungi in waste mixtures were significantly (P ? 0.05) increased during vermicomposting. Higher cellulase activity in treatments having 50% or more vinasse might be attributed to the significantly (P ? 0.05) higher concentration of group I isozyme while concentrations of other isozymes (group II and III) of cellulase were statistically at par. Higher chitin content in vinasse-enriched treatments suggested that fungal biomass and fungi-to-microbial biomass ratio in these treatments were also increased due to vermicomposting. Results revealed that Eudrilus eugeniae and Eisenia fetida had comparable effect on FA and VN mixture during vermicomposting. Periodical analysis of above-mentioned biochemical and microbial properties and nutrient content of final vermicompost samples indicated that equal proportion (1:1, w/w) of FA and VN is probably the optimum composition to obtain best quality vermicompost.  相似文献

The physical and chemical properties of crude oils differ greatly, and these properties change significantly once oil is spilled into the marine environment as a result of a number of weathering processes. Quantitative information on the weathering of spilled crude is a fundamental requirement for a fuller understanding of the fate and behaviour of oil in the environment. Additionally, such data are also essential for estimating windows-of-opportunities, where specific response methods, technologies, equipment or products are most effective in clean-up operations. In this study, the effects of a relatively low toxicity compound, biodiesel (rape seed oil methyl ester) on the rate of removal and weathering characteristics of crude oil within artificial sand columns are thoroughly investigated using GC/MS techniques. In the absence of the biodiesel, the crude oil exhibits low mobility and a slow rate of microbial degradation within the sediment and as a result, a high degree of persistance. Brent crude oil was subject to a progressive loss of the low molecular weight n-alkanes with respect to time through evaporation and a preferential migration of these fractions through the sediment to depth. The addition of the biodiesel led to greater recovery of oil from the sediment if applied to relatively unweathered crude oil. This was as the result of the crude oil dissolving within the more mobile biodiesel. The negligible concentration of the n-C10 to n-C21 fraction in surface sediment samples suggests a greater solubility of these fractions within the biodiesel and that their subsequent adsorption onto subsurface sediment particles was responsible for their absence from water flushed through the sands. These results suggest that biodiesel may have an active role in the beach clean-up of spilt crude oil.  相似文献

The objective of this work was to determine the composition and production rate of dental solid waste, produced by dental practices in the Prefecture of Xanthi, a multicultural area in Northeast Greece with a population of 102,000. For the study, 22 private dental practices and 1 public dental practice were selected of the 48 private and 5 public dental practices in operation. The 22 private dental practices included 16 owned by Christian Greek-born dentists, 3 by Moslem dentists and 3 by Christian dentists repatriated from the former Soviet Union. Differentiation on the basis of religion is directly related to the countries from which dentists received their training, e.g., Greece-European Union, Turkey and former Soviet Union. Thus, including the one public dental practice, 4 study groups were considered. Waste collection took place for 22 working days, from 20 May to 27 June 2002. This period was considered to be a representative one for a semi-rural area, such as Xanthi. Dentists were instructed to collect the total amount of waste they produced. A total of 260 kg dental solid waste was collected during the study period and was manually separated. Dental solid waste was classified in three main categories: (1) Infectious and potentially infectious waste, accounting for 94.7% by weight. (2) Non-infectious waste accounting for 2.0%. (3) Domestic-type waste, accounting for 3.3% by weight. The category of infectious waste is classified as hazardous and includes components containing metal (8.51%), components without metal (91.18%) and amalgam (0.33%). Using the weight data, the production rate of dental solid waste for the study period in the Prefecture of Xanthi was determined to be 513 g/practice/day and of infectious and potentially infectious waste 486 g/practice/day. The latter includes the production rate of sharps (9.8 g/practice/day), non-sharps (31.6), infectious waste without metal (443) and amalgam (1.6 g/practice/day). Since dental solid waste is currently disposed of in landfills together with the municipal solid waste, the results of the study were used to suggest an appropriate management scheme. The results were also used to compare the composition and production rates of dental solid waste produced by the 4 study groups.  相似文献

The aim of this study was to investigate the effect of rumen fluid and leachate-based media on the ability of rumen and anaerobic digester derived microorganisms to degrade cellulose. The results demonstrated that rumen microorganisms are not capable of solubilising cellulose, or generating biomass, at an optimal rate when grown in leachate-based media when compared to the rates achieved when grown in rumen-based media. In contrast, the rate of biomass generation and cellulose solubilisation by digester microorganisms was not strongly affected by a change in media type. Several authors have theorised that cellulose degradation rates in anaerobic digesters can be increased by inoculation with rumen-derived microorganisms. The results from this study show that this approach is unlikely to be successful, because the rumen microorganisms would likely be unable to solubilise and out-compete native solid waste microorganisms for the cellulose in a foreign (leachate based) medium.  相似文献
